My partner, daughter and I decided to try somewhere new for lunch the last time we visited…read moreScarborough. Restaurant 55 is on the Main street leading up to town from the seafront. We didn't know what to expect when we went in, as it looked a bit drab - but when my other half is hungry he needs feeding and the waiter that greeted us showed us to a table next to the window with lovely views of the seafront. It didn't take us long to decide what we wanted, fish and chips for him, half a chicken for me and an extra plate as daughter usually shares with us. We waited quite a while for our food, but it was worth the wait as it was exceptional! The chicken was moist and flavorsome, and the chips, cooked in their skins and seasoned with herbs and what looked like sea salt were devine! The fish my partner assured me between mouth fulls was wonderful also! and the waiter was more than happy to provide the extra plate for my daughter and there was more than enough food for all three of us! We were really pleased and surprised at finding Restaurant 55, the prices were reasonable, the view gorgeous and more importantly the food.. YUMMY

This is one of three restaurants owned by Andrew Pern- a Michelin star chef for another one of his…read morerestaurants called Star Inn at Harem which is in Helmsley. His third restaurant is in York: Star Inn the City. It is important to keep this in mind when going to The Star Inn the Harbour- it is a seaside restaurant catering to tourists who want a quick bite of fish and chips, but it also has a reputation at stake. We went for the fish and chips- although my husband doesn't like fried fish so he got the grilled fish of the day which was Hike and it was fabulous- perfectly cooked and presented (see the photo). We shared an order of Mashed Peas which were perfectly seasoned. I got the fish and chips and it was delicious- served with malt vinegar and tartar sauce. I wouldn't get it on a regular basis- too heavy for me- but being on vacation in England, I had to try it at least once and this is the place to try it!!

What a disappointment when you have visited the Star Inn at Harome before!…read moreCertainly: a stunning location, the old tourist informtation perfectly converted into a pleasant restaurant with marvellous views across the harbour to Whitby Abbey and St. Mary´s. A welcoming friendly service, but that`s all of it. OK, the oysters were fresh, but what can you do wrong on oysters? The brill wallowed on a completely off-tasting brown sauce, which seems to be a undiluted 1:1 mixture of soy sauce and vinegar in which worm-like soaky noodles were paddling (looks a bit like fried bosse intestine in China). Yellow tuna (a member on the red list of Greenpeace; that much to local fish!) finished with anchovis, olives and pickled mini cobs, ruining the original taste of the fish completely. And for what reason "Maris Piper" is highlighted as their potato variety of choice: its the most common grown ordinary mass variety in the UK but also one of the most susceptible potato varieties to being eaten by slugs. What`s positive: after complaining, they did not charge for the fish anymore! Well done, but no second chance!
